Gujarat Titans (GT) seamer Arshad Khan stated that the staff is getting ready effectively for the continuing Indian Premier League (IPL) play-offs, discussing previous errors to enhance, and planning for the upcoming match in opposition to Mumbai Indians (MI) in Qualifier 1 on Friday (May 30, 2025).
Punjab stayed on the high of the standings, whereas RCB moved to the second spot. RCB have booked a date with Punjab Kings in Qualifier 1 on Thursday (May 29, 2025), whereas Gujarat Titans, who slipped to 3rd, will face Mumbai Indians within the Eliminator on Friday (May 30, 2025).
“We are making good preparations for the play-offs. We have discussed the mistakes that we have made in the past. And we are preparing to make it better. And we are planning well for the upcoming matches,” Khan stated in a media interplay.
Arshad additionally spoke about Gujarat’s center order.
“I think our middle order is not getting exposed. So, no one knows how strong our middle order is… And our lower order is also very good. So, I think that is why everyone is not getting exposed. But it is nothing like that. Our middle order is very strong. And we are preparing for the upcoming matches.”
Khan additionally mirrored on their earlier fixture in opposition to Chennai Super Kings, acknowledging it wasn’t their greatest. He emphasised the significance of successful within the eliminator or qualifier, viewing the additional recreation as a chance to succeed in and win the ultimate.
“I think our last game was not that good. But now that we are talking about our eliminator, whether we play the eliminator or the qualifier, it is important to win. So, we are getting to play an extra game, which is God’s plan. So, we will try to play an extra game and reach the final and then win the final,” he added.
